Three signals from Sydenham

Hyperlocal compresses each suburb into the three signals that decide whether it's right for you. For Sydenham:

Signal 1

Watergardens shopping + Sunbury line terminus; 35–45 min train to Southern Cross

Signal 2

Long commute vs Footscray/Yarraville — adds 20+ min each way

Signal 3

Family-skewed: school catchments + cul-de-sac estates dominate

Prices in Sydenham · A$5k–7k / m²

Research-calibrated medians for Sydenham, Melbourne — a researched snapshot calibrated against realestate.com.au + Domain + CoreLogic 2025, not a live feed. When the data is refreshed, automated sanity bounds auto-reject any record that moves more than ±40% in a single cycle.

A$410kApartment buy median
A$720kHouse buy median
A$440 / weekApartment rent median
A$460 / weekHouse rent median
Source: realestate.com.au + Domain + CoreLogic 2025 · 2025 snapshot

Investor lens · Moderate conviction

Moderate conviction 3–5 year horizon

One or two real drivers exist but the thesis is execution-dependent — depends on infrastructure being delivered on schedule or employers expanding as announced.

What's driving the case

  • Sunbury line + Watergardens mall
  • Family-home affordability
What could break the thesis
  • Mature stock + road capacity constraints
  • Some arterial-adjacent streets
